Abstract (EN)
Investment rating in a best way and to protect the value of financial resources have always been a hot-button issue. Since political structure, sociological issues and time are the variables that effect the financial resources, the investors decision making is getting hard. The observed variations are named as volatility in the economy.The purpose in this study is to search the possible best modelling of financial information that is effected from time and psychological factors. In order to achieve this, non-linear time series models are examined since they are one of the best econometric methods that involves volatility.Istanbul Stock Exchange data, between the dates 02.01.1997 - 31.12.2008 are used to implement these models, because the data contains volatility besides they are flexible through time. During the implementation, Imkb 100 yield index is used and the most possible model is examined.
